I THINK Peter Dolan (HAS, July 12) must have lived in another country when we had 18 years of Tory rule.
He states that under Labour, the pensioner's lot has gone backwards.
Consider the following: heating allowance now £200 for couples and £100 if single - £10 under the Tories; eye tests now free - paid for under the Tories; free television licences for over-75s; free bus passes.
All of these would be taken away by the Tories.
Gordon Hodgson, Bishop Auckland, Co Durham.
